Decision: Salford City Council - Record of Decision
I, Councillor Tracy Kelly, Statutory Deputy City Mayor and Lead Member for Housing, in exercise of the powers contained within the Council Constitution, do hereby: · Note the content of this report with specific regard being given to the legal and finance sections, which are based on information provided by Shared Legal Services as follows:
The paper outlines the proposal for Mr B to be granted a discretionary DFG without the requirement for means testing. Legal Services have confirmed this is in accordance within current government guidance. Should this be approved the full cost estimated to be in the region of £17K-£20K (subject to reassessment) will be met from the Disabled Facilities Grant (DFG) and sufficient funds are available to meet this cost;
· Note the content of the letter provided by Mr B in respect of the impact of the current situation on himself and his daughter;
· Agree to the request for discretionary assistance in the form of direct financial assistant (grant) without a charge for an adaptation at Mr B property to cover the reasonable costs of the works specified following the DFG assessment as necessary and appropriate to support him in the provision of safe and dignified care of his daughter; therefore removing the requirement for Mr B to provide financial information to the Council.
· Note any issues arising from this case to be taken in account when the Private Sector Housing Assistance Policy is next reviewed.
To meet the Council’s statutory obligations in order to support assessed need and promote independence and wellbeing.
Options considered and rejected were: Not to provide the Disabled Facilities Grant.
The risk is considered to be medium in terms of the financial and reputational risks faced by Salford City Council and Salford Care Organisation.
The source of funding is: Disabled Facilities Grant.
Legal Advice obtained: Provided by Hugo Hollingswoth, Principal Solicitor, Shared Legal Service: The proposal that Mr B be granted a discretionary DFG without the requirement for means testing is in accordance with current government guidance.
Financial Advice obtained: Provided by Stephen Thynne, Strategic Finance Manager. The paper outlines the proposal for Mr B to be granted a discretionary DFG without the requirement for means testing. Legal Services have confirmed this is in accordance within current government guidance. Should this be approved the full cost estimated to be in the region of £17K-£20K (subject to reassessment) will be met from the DFG and sufficient funds are available to meet this cost.
